## Deploying the Gatewick Proctor Queue

Deploys are pretty painless: push to main, wait for the pipeline, then watch the queue drain dashboard for five minutes. If candidates pile up mid-exam, roll back first and ask questions later — the queue replays safely. Everything the workers care about lives in one config block, shown here for reference.

settings of bafof-yagef:
JOROX_PIN=8740
JOROX_TENANT=pelox
JOROX_METRICS_HOST=metrics.jorox.qorvelworks.internal
JOROX_SEAL=seal_c78f63c1
JOROX_STANDBY_TEAM=norax

Ticket: Prototype workshop door acting up again

Hey facilities folks — the reader on the Wrenfield prototype workshop (Building D, ground floor) has been flaky all week. Badges work maybe one try in three, and the Quillon team keeps getting locked out mid-build, which is not great when someone's holding a hot glue rig. Can someone swap the reader or at least reseat it? In the meantime we've enabled the keypad fallback, so let the team in with the code below.

staff pass of kagup-fajog = bdg-QCHVQW-99665837

**Q: How do I unlock the Veldrin GPU memory profiler for a customer session?**

A: The profiler attaches to the customer's render process and records allocation snapshots per frame. Because these snapshots may contain texture data, access is gated behind the support vault. Confirm the customer has signed the diagnostics consent form first, then unlock the profiler bundle with the passphrase below.

unlock words, hahip-baduf: holwyn-istath-julvan

Heads up for review: the Rowline seat-map renderer for the Gilden Theatre was rendering the balcony as general admission because staging env vars leaked into the prod build. I've split the files properly and pinned `VENUE_PROFILE=gilden-main` so the tiered layout loads. The diff also drops the old hardcoded fallback, which means the renderer now genuinely requires its tile-service credential at startup or it bails early. That credential is set in the env file on the very next line.

env line for fafof-fahag: LEDGER_TOKEN5=f8790